Police Raid IPOB Camp In Enugu, Neutralize Three, Recover Weapons

Written by on August 11, 2023

The Enugu State Police Command said that it had neutralized three operatives of the Eastern Security Network of the Indigenous People of Biafra in the Igbo-Eze North Local Government Area of the state and recovered their weapons.

The command’s spokesman, DSP Daniel Ndukwe, disclosed this in a statement made available to journalists in Enugu on Friday.

Ndukwe said that the hoodlums were killed when a combined team of police Special Forces and operatives serving in the Igbo-Eze North Police Division raided their camp at Imufu area of the council on Thursday.

According to Ndukwe, when the operatives engaged in a gun duel with the subversive criminal elements, “three of the hoodlums were neutralised in the ensuing gunfight,” adding that many others escaped with varying degrees of gunshot wounds.
